Getting Closer Now…

We have been living back on our Taswell 43 sailboat for over 2 weeks now.ย  Love it, it is cozy, comfortable, and we are working away at all the needed jobs to do before we take off.

mahicleangalleyI am happy to report that Mahi once again has refrigeration!!ย  It is so much easier to live on board when you do. Our compressor had failed, plus the relay switch.ย  Also, we needed to up the power from 15 amp to 20 amp service.ย  Works great!

Here (shown above) is what my fridge and freezer looks like in my galley, it is top loading for both and an additional bottom opening for the refrigerator, too.ย  I would like to tell you my galley is always that clean, but right now I have a provisioning pile back near the microwave.ย  Oh yes, a new toaster, too.

IMG_8224Cooking with our propane Force 10 stove is a breeze!ย  Have learned the settings to control the pressure cooker, too.ย  Here is a tortellini meatball soup cooking away under pressure.ย  This dish is yummy!

Last night I made a tasty pot roast dish in our Kuhn Rikon pressure cooker to have with fresh bread.ย  We can eat our leftovers now, or I can freeze them to eat while in the Bahamas.

Love this pressure cooker.ย  Hope to carve out some time to can before we go.ย  Thanks to Behan Gifford at SV Totem, for sharing how she cans with her pressure cooker, too.

IMG_8212IMG_8209The cushions are now back on Mahi.ย  On my “to-do” list are to sew up some cushion covers out of the turquoise microfiber fabric you see in the pictures.ย  Right now, I just tucked them under until I can get to that job.

In the first picture you see our TV/DVD player mounted on the wall.ย  In the second photo, You see the other side of the salon seating area.ย  Right now, I have the small table on.ย  This is because it is easier to provision behind the settee and under the cushions with the smaller table mounted.ย  It will be replaced with the large table once I am finished provisioning.ย  Notice, too, I have to mount the Mahi painting to the wall.ย  This is done with industrial strength velcro mounts.

IMG_8195Here is the navigation station with the new chair installed.ย  This is across from the salon settee shown above.ย  This gives you an idea for what our main salon looks like.ย  Actually, we have changed out some electronics since this photo was taken, also covered the empty hole with black starboard.

Now we need to add on a new barometer, too, plus have added our small on board printer back on the right hand side.

Newest purchases?ย  Wifi booster and a Iridium Go! Satellite phone.ย  More about that once we get it installed.ย  Almost there!!
